Connect the keyed end of the sup-
plied Network Cable to the LAN
jack on the telephone, and connect
the shorter end to the network
(LAN) port. Connect the DC plug
of the AC wall adapter into the sup-
plied LAN cable as shown.

If the telephone is connected to a compat-
ible ethernet switch that can provide in-line
power, the telephone will use that power
option. Simply plug the keyed end of the In-
Line Power Cable (optional accessory) into
the LAN jack on the telephone and connect
the shorter end of this cable to an available
power and data port on the In-Line Power
switch. The AC wall adapter is not required
when using In-Line power.
